Как лучше хранить данные о маршруте водителей?

При хранении данных о маршруте водителей в MySQL есть несколько подходов, и выбор определенного подхода может зависеть от конкретных требований и ограничений вашего проекта. В данном ответе я рассмотрю несколько возможных вариантов и рекомендации по выбору наиболее подходящего. 1. Сохранение данных в одной таблице: В этом подходе создается одна таблица, в которой каждая запись содержит ... Читать далее

Есть ли подводные камни у разворачивания на хостинге продуктов mySQL Workbench?

MySQL Workbench - это графическая среда разработки и администрирования MySQL, которая предоставляет мощные инструменты для работы с базой данных. При разворачивании продуктов MySQL Workbench на хостинге есть несколько подводных камней, на которые следует обратить внимание. 1. Требования к хостингу: Убедитесь, что ваш хостинг может поддерживать MySQL Workbench и имеет необходимые зависимости для его работы. Убедитесь, ... Читать далее

Как запросом проверить входит ли дата из списка в диапазон дат?

Для проверки того, входит ли дата из списка в заданный диапазон дат в MySQL, вы можете использовать операторы сравнения (<, <=, >, >=) и логические операторы (AND, OR) в комбинации с предикатом BETWEEN или оператором IN. Предположим, что у вас есть таблица orders, в которой есть столбец order_date, содержащий даты заказов. И вам нужно проверить, ... Читать далее

Как выбрать данные в таблице в custom колонки представления?

Чтобы выбрать данные в таблице и представить их в пользовательских колонках представления в MySQL, вам понадобится использовать выражение SELECT с указанием нужных колонок и алиасов. Прежде чем перейти к выборке данных из таблицы, необходимо создать представление в MySQL с помощью оператора CREATE VIEW. Это позволит вам определить структуру представления и использовать его для выборки данных. ... Читать далее

Как сделать проверку на SqlConnection и передавать его в другие WinForms?

Для проверки наличия подключения к базе данных MySQL и передачи объекта SqlConnection в другие формы WinForms, вам необходимо выполнить следующие шаги: 1. Установите MySQL Connector/NET, если его еще нет. Connector/NET - это официальный драйвер для работы с базами данных MySQL в среде .NET. Вы можете скачать его с официального сайта MySQL (https://dev.mysql.com/downloads/connector/net/) и установить его ... Читать далее

Как стоит организовать хранение данных mysql?

Организация хранения данных в MySQL является важным аспектом разработки приложений, и влияет на производительность, масштабируемость и надежность вашей базы данных. Вот несколько рекомендаций по организации хранения данных в MySQL: 1. Нормализация таблиц: Применение нормализации помогает устранить избыточность данных и повышает эффективность обращения к ним. Одна из основных концепций нормализации - это разделение информации на разные ... Читать далее

Как заменить все совпадения в БД MySQL?

Для замены всех совпадений в базе данных MySQL можно использовать оператор UPDATE с использованием функции REPLACE. Функция REPLACE позволяет заменить все вхождения одной строки на другую строку в определенном столбце таблицы. Синтаксис оператора UPDATE с использованием функции REPLACE выглядит следующим образом: UPDATE таблица SET столбец = REPLACE(столбец, 'заменяемая_строка', 'заменяющая_строка') WHERE условие; Где: - таблица - ... Читать далее

Как выполнить SQL запрос с присоединением другой таблицы?

Для выполнения SQL запроса с присоединением другой таблицы в MySQL, вы можете использовать оператор JOIN. JOIN позволяет объединить данные из двух или более таблиц, основываясь на условии соединения. Существуют различные типы JOIN: INNER JOIN, LEFT JOIN, RIGHT JOIN и FULL JOIN. INNER JOIN возвращает только те строки, которые имеют соответствие в обеих таблицах. Он объединяет ... Читать далее

Что лучше: больше полей или больше Join?

Определение, что лучше - больше полей или больше Join, зависит от конкретной ситуации и требований вашего проекта. Рассмотрим оба подхода в подробностях: 1. Больше полей: - Преимущества: - Простота запросов: если у вас большое количество полей, вы можете получить все необходимые данные в одном запросе, без необходимости объединения нескольких таблиц. - Уменьшение нагрузки на сервер ... Читать далее

Как исправить ошибку при импорте БД MySQL (Некорректное значение по умолчанию)?

Ошибки при импорте БД MySQL могут возникать по разным причинам, включая некорректное значение по умолчанию. В данном случае, чтобы исправить эту ошибку, нужно выполнить следующие шаги: 1. Проверьте схему БД: сначала убедитесь, что структура БД, включая таблицы, поля и значения по умолчанию, соответствует требованиям вашего приложения. 2. Откройте файл импорта: откройте файл SQL, который вы ... Читать далее